Marking his home in San Francisco since 1998, Paolo, a native of Manila, literally landed his “chenelas” on house nation soil and hit the ground running. Not having access to turntables, Paolo’s passion for house urged him to fiddle with virtual turntables on his PC and picking upvinyl whenever finances could afford it. By 2001, Paolo frequented many house parties and one in particular, OM’s monthly that featured Mark Farina and a five hour set by Derrick Carter, would reflect an inspiration and motive to put his “fiddling” into reality. Not much later he bumped elbows with another aspiring musician, Brian Salazar and with friends, they created they’re own satirical crew, The Housemen and female counterparts, The Housewives. Since then he has forged a sound that is soulful, groovy and pumped with vivacious horns, percussion, spanking bass lines, unstoppable breakdowns and sultry vocals. Shortly after, Paolo played a bevy of smaller house parties in the Bay Area, including some ventures in Los Angeles with fellow Housemen, Darwin Paul and Justin Michael. Word of mouth spread quickly and he was then booked at Remedy, SF’s legendary soulful/funky house party. Paolo is also a regular at The Cardiff Lounge in Campbell and held a residency at Infusion Lounge in SF. Ever consistent and growing, he has graced the decks with powerhouses, Grant Nelson, Jamie Lewis, Jay-J at WMC 2006. Kaskade, Jask, David Harness, Chuck Love, David Harness, Andy Caldwell, Julius Papp, Ruben Mancias, Craig C of the Pound Boys, Deepswing, & Patrick Wilson are among the other big names that he has had the honor of sharing the decks with. Although his djing career has been blessed, Paolo still has plans on not just playing locally but also internationally, including a return trip to his motherland.
